Skontaktuj się z nami

info@serverion.com

Zadzwoń do nas

+1 (302) 380 3902

Jak zmniejszyć opóźnienie w sieciach Blockchain

Chcesz szybszych transakcji blockchain? Oto, w jaki sposób możesz zmniejszyć opóźnienia i poprawić wydajność swojej sieci blockchain:

  • Strategiczne rozmieszczenie węzłów:Rozprzestrzenianie węzłów na całym świecie, ze szczególnym uwzględnieniem obszarów o dużej aktywności transakcyjnej, koncentracji użytkowników i przeciążeniu sieci.
  • Przetwarzanie brzegowe:Przetwarzaj transakcje bliżej użytkowników, aby zmniejszyć opóźnienia i wykorzystanie przepustowości.
  • Fragmentowanie:Podziel blockchain na mniejsze części, aby móc obsługiwać więcej transakcji jednocześnie.
  • Zoptymalizowane ustawienia sieciowe:Używaj szybkich połączeń, skutecznie zarządzaj przepustowością i wdrażaj wydajne mechanizmy konsensusu.
  • Nowoczesna infrastruktura:Wykorzystaj sieci CDN, wydajny sprzęt (procesory wielordzeniowe, szybkie pamięci masowe) i zaawansowane projekty blockchain, takie jak dowód historii lub skalowanie warstwy 2.
  • Monitorowanie wydajności:Śledź wydajność węzła, automatyzuj aktualizacje i równoważ obciążenia, aby unikać wąskich gardeł.

Szybka wskazówka: Połączenie tych metod zapewnia szybsze przetwarzanie transakcji, niższe opłaty i płynniejsze doświadczenie użytkownika. Gotowy na głębsze zanurzenie? Przyjrzyjmy się tym taktykom krok po kroku.

Minimalizuj opóźnienia w węzłach Blockchain ⏱️

Metody rozmieszczania węzłów

Strategiczne rozmieszczenie węzłów jest kluczem do skrócenia opóźnień blockchain. Fizyczne umiejscowienie węzłów wpływa na szybkość przetwarzania i walidacji transakcji w sieci.

Globalna dystrybucja węzłów

Rozmieszczenie węzłów na całym świecie pozwala zminimalizować przesyłanie danych i przyspieszyć przetwarzanie transakcji poprzez kierowanie ich przez pobliskie węzły.

Aby uzyskać najlepsze rezultaty, rozmieszczenie węzłów powinno odbywać się na podstawie:

  • Gęstość transakcji:Dodaj więcej węzłów w obszarach o dużej aktywności.
  • Przeciążenie sieci:Wdrażaj węzły, aby zapobiegać powstawaniu wąskich gardeł w ruchu.
  • Koncentracja użytkownika:Umieść węzły w regionach, w których jest wielu użytkowników.

Świetnym przykładem jest globalna konfiguracja Serverion, która obejmuje centra danych w USA, UE i Azji. Ten rodzaj infrastruktury tworzy silny szkielet sieciowy dla operacji blockchain. Teraz przyjrzyjmy się, w jaki sposób przetwarzanie brzegowe może jeszcze bardziej zmniejszyć opóźnienia.

Korzyści z sieci Edge

Edge computing przenosi przetwarzanie transakcji bliżej użytkowników. Poprzez lokalne przetwarzanie danych zamiast kierowania ich przez odległe węzły centralne, opóźnienia znacznie spadają. Taka konfiguracja zmniejsza również wykorzystanie przepustowości i poprawia ogólną wydajność. Rezultat? Krótsze czasy reakcji i lepsza wydajność – niezbędne dla zdecentralizowanych systemów. Następnym krokiem w udoskonalaniu tej strategii jest sharding.

Dystrybucja węzłów z wykorzystaniem partycjonowania

Połączenie rozmieszczenia węzłów z shardingiem przenosi wydajność na wyższy poziom. Sharding dzieli blockchain na mniejsze części (shardy), zachowując jednocześnie bezpieczeństwo i decentralizację. Umieszczając węzły w systemie shardingowym, należy wziąć pod uwagę:

  • Dystrybucja geograficzna:Rozłóż węzły na różne regiony dla każdego fragmentu.
  • Równoważenie obciążenia:Zapewnij równomierne rozłożenie mocy przetwarzania.
  • Komunikacja międzyodłamkowa:Zminimalizuj odległość między węzłami, które ze sobą oddziałują.

Optymalizacja konfiguracji sieci

Dostosowanie ustawień sieciowych może pomóc zmniejszyć opóźnienie blockchain i poprawić szybkość i niezawodność transakcji. Kolejnym kluczowym krokiem jest ocena metod konsensusu i zarządzania ruchem w celu zwiększenia ogólnej wydajności.

Zarządzanie przepustowością

Korzystanie z szybkich dedykowanych połączeń zapewnia szybszy transfer danych, a posiadanie wystarczającej przepustowości obsługuje wymagania obecnych systemów blockchain. Na przykład Serverion dedykowane serwery oferują do 10 TB miesięcznej przepustowości, zapewniając stabilną łączność dla płynnego działania technologii blockchain.

Nowoczesna konfiguracja infrastruktury

Nowoczesna infrastruktura odgrywa kluczową rolę w poprawie wydajności blockchain poprzez wykorzystanie zaawansowanych technologii w celu zminimalizowania opóźnień i przyspieszenia przetwarzania transakcji. Dobrze zaplanowana konfiguracja jest niezbędna sieci blockchain działać efektywnie.

Wdrożenie CDN

Sieci dostarczania treści (CDN) pomagają przyspieszyć transfer danych poprzez buforowanie i dystrybucję danych blockchain w wielu lokalizacjach na świecie. Niektóre skuteczne strategie obejmują:

  • Buforowanie brzegowe:Przechowywanie często używanych danych bliżej użytkowników, na skraju sieci.
  • Dynamiczne trasowanie:Automatyczne kierowanie żądań do najbliższego i najbardziej responsywnego węzła.

Rozważania dotyczące sprzętu

Wysokowydajny sprzęt jest niezbędny do płynnych operacji blockchain z minimalnymi opóźnieniami. Kluczowe komponenty, które należy traktować priorytetowo, obejmują:

  • Procesory wielordzeniowe do wykonywania złożonych obliczeń.
  • Dużo pamięci do zarządzania dużymi zbiorami danych.
  • Szybkie rozwiązania pamięci masowej, takie jak dyski SSD NVMe, umożliwiające szybkie operacje odczytu i zapisu.
  • Niezawodne, szybkie połączenia sieciowe.

Najlepsza konfiguracja sprzętowa zależy od konkretnych potrzeb Twojej sieci blockchain i jej obciążenia. Ponadto nowe projekty blockchain są stale rozwijane, aby jeszcze bardziej ograniczyć opóźnienia.

Nowe systemy Blockchain

Nowe platformy blockchain wprowadzają kreatywne metody zmniejszania opóźnień i zwiększania wydajności. Na przykład Solana używa proof-of-history do oznaczania transakcji znacznikami czasu przed konsensusem, osiągając finalność poniżej sekundy. Inne nowoczesne techniki obejmują:

  • Równoległe przetwarzanie transakcji:Umożliwia obsługę wielu transakcji jednocześnie.
  • Skalowanie warstwy 2:Przeniesienie części procesów do warstw drugorzędnych w celu przyspieszenia czasu transakcji.
  • Adaptacyjne rozmiary bloków:Dynamiczne dostosowywanie rozmiarów bloków na podstawie aktywności sieciowej.

Systemy te wymagają infrastruktury klasy korporacyjnej z dedykowanymi zasobami, aby zagwarantować płynne działanie i utrzymać wysoką wydajność.

Zarządzanie wydajnością węzła

Efektywne zarządzanie węzłami pozwala ograniczyć opóźnienia w łańcuchu bloków dzięki ciągłemu monitorowaniu i dostrajaniu.

Narzędzia do śledzenia wydajności

Sieci blockchain zależą od śledzenia podstawowych metryk, aby zapewnić płynne działanie. Kluczowe narzędzia powinny monitorować:

  • Status synchronizacji:Śledzi postęp synchronizacji i identyfikuje opóźnione węzły.
  • Opóźnienie sieciowe: Mierzy prędkość połączenia między węzłami w celu wykrycia opóźnień.
  • Wykorzystanie zasobów: Monitoruje wykorzystanie procesora, pamięci i magazynu.
  • Przepustowość transakcji:Oblicza liczbę transakcji na sekundę (TPS) w celu oceny wydajności.

Informacje te są niezbędne do przeprowadzania automatycznych aktualizacji, dzięki którym węzły działają sprawnie.

Automatyczne aktualizacje węzłów

Wykorzystując spostrzeżenia z monitorowania wydajności, automatyczne aktualizacje pomagają utrzymać optymalną funkcjonalność systemu. Te aktualizacje koncentrują się na:

  • Kontrola wersji: Automatyczne stosowanie poprawek zabezpieczeń i aktualizacji protokołów.
  • Zarządzanie konfiguracją:Zapewnienie spójności ustawień we wszystkich węzłach.
  • Kontrole zdrowia:Regularnie przeprowadzane testy w celu oceny wydajności węzła.
  • Opcje wycofywania:Szybkie cofanie zmian, jeśli aktualizacja powoduje problemy.

W przypadku sieci obsługujących zadania krytyczne, zaplanuj aktualizacje w okresach niskiego ruchu, aby uniknąć przerw. Po zakończeniu aktualizacji rozkład obciążenia zapewnia spójną wydajność we wszystkich węzłach.

Systemy dystrybucji obciążenia

Dystrybucja obciążenia jest kluczowa dla utrzymania wydajności, zwłaszcza podczas szczytów ruchu. Nowoczesne strategie obejmują:

Dynamiczne równoważenie obciążenia

  • Monitoruje ruch w czasie rzeczywistym.
  • Automatycznie redystrybuuje obciążenia.
  • Przydziela zadania na podstawie pojemności węzła.

Dystrybucja geograficzna

  • Rozmieszcza węzły strategicznie w regionach.
  • Kieruje ruch do najbliższych dostępnych węzłów.
  • Dodaje redundancję w celu ochrony krytycznych części sieci.

Podczas konfigurowania dystrybucji obciążenia, kluczowe jest utrzymanie synchronizacji węzłów przy jednoczesnym rozłożeniu obciążenia. Zapewnia to spójność danych i zapobiega przeciążeniu pojedynczego węzła. Strategie te współpracują ze sobą, aby sieci blockchain były wydajne i responsywne.

W przypadku rozwiązań blockchain dla przedsiębiorstw, specjalistyczne opcje hostingu, takie jak Hosting Masternode Blockchain firmy Serverion zapewnić dedykowaną infrastrukturę, całodobowy monitoring i wsparcie. Zapewnia to niezawodną wydajność i minimalizuje opóźnienia w sieci.

Wniosek

Najważniejsze wnioski

Aby zmniejszyć opóźnienie łańcucha bloków, należy zwrócić szczególną uwagę na rozmieszczenie węzłów, konfigurację sieci, infrastrukturę i bieżące zarządzanie wydajnością:

  • Strategiczne rozmieszczenie węzłów: Dystrybucja węzłów w różnych lokalizacjach globalnych minimalizuje opóźnienia i przyspiesza przetwarzanie transakcji. Techniki takie jak sieci brzegowe i sharding pomagają utrzymać zasoby bliżej użytkowników.
  • Zoptymalizowana konfiguracja sieci:Właściwy przydział pasma i wydajne metody konsensusu zapewniają szybkość sieci nawet przy dużym obciążeniu.
  • Ulepszenia infrastruktury:Używanie CDN i odpowiednich specyfikacji sprzętowych zapewnia płynne działanie. Łączenie nowoczesnych systemów blockchain z wysokiej jakości sprzętem pomaga zmniejszyć opóźnienia.
  • Monitorowanie wydajności:Narzędzia do specjalistycznego monitorowania, automatycznych aktualizacji i równoważenia obciążenia pomagają unikać wąskich gardeł.

Wszystkie te kroki łącznie tworzą kompleksowe podejście mające na celu poprawę efektywności technologii blockchain.

ServerionOferty firmy

Serverion

Serverion zapewnia niezawodne rozwiązanie pozwalające na redukcję opóźnień dzięki Hosting Masternode Blockchain. Ich usługi obejmują:

  • Infrastruktura najwyższej klasy:Serwery dedykowane z Czas sprawności 99,99% dla niezawodnej wydajności.
  • Zasięg globalny:37 centrów danych strategicznie rozmieszczonych w USA, UE i Azji.
  • Zwiększone bezpieczeństwoWbudowana ochrona DDoS zapewniająca bezpieczeństwo operacji.
  • Całodobowy monitoring:Eksperckie wsparcie i ciągłe monitorowanie wydajności.

Powiązane wpisy na blogu

pl_PL